Why pet turf smells and how to prevent it

Odor comes from urine converting to ammonia and uric salts. Stop the smell by keeping water moving through the system and neutralizing residue at the surface. Smart build choices plus a simple routine keep turf fresh for the long haul.

What actually causes odor

  • Urine breaks down into ammonia and uric acid crystals that cling to fibers and infill.
  • Poor drainage traps liquids, giving bacteria time to multiply.
  • Organic debris like leaves and hair create a food source for microbes.
  • Heat intensifies ammonia smell. Shaded, stagnant areas can develop a musty odor.

Build it right from the start

  • Subgrade prep: remove organics, compact firmly, and create 1 to 2 percent slope away from structures.
  • Base layer: install 3 to 4 inches of angular, open graded aggregate for fast percolation. Avoid fine heavy mixes that hold water.
  • Drainage aids: add drain tile or channels in low spots and daylight them where possible.
  • Turf backing: choose a perforated or flow through backing with high drainage capacity.
  • Infill strategy: finish with a top layer of zeolite or antimicrobial infill to capture ammonia. Typical zeolite loading is 1 to 2 pounds per square foot on pet zones.
  • Secure seams and edges so waste cannot collect in gaps.

Upkeep that keeps it fresh

  • Daily: remove solids and give hotspot areas a quick hose rinse.
  • Weekly: light hose rinse across the area to move residues through the base.
  • Biweekly to monthly: apply a pet safe bio enzymatic cleaner that targets urea and uric salts. Follow label directions and let it dwell before rinsing.
  • Quarterly: groom fibers with a stiff broom, clear debris, and top off zeolite if traffic is heavy.

Enzymes and infills that work

  • Bio enzymatic cleaners use beneficial bacteria and enzymes to digest odor compounds. They neutralize the source rather than masking it.
  • Zeolite binds ammonia molecules, reducing odor spikes between rinses. Antimicrobial coated sands add ongoing microbe control.
  • Avoid harsh chlorine bleach, solvents, oil based deodorizers, and aggressive pressure washing. If you use baking soda, apply sparingly and rinse thoroughly to prevent residue.

Climate and multi pet realities

  • Hot or arid climates: increase rinse frequency and consider higher zeolite loading.
  • Humid climates: focus on airflow and periodic deep enzyme soaks.
  • Multiple dogs or kennel use: plan for more frequent enzyme treatments and proactive drainage design.

Troubleshooting odor

  • Ammonia sting after a basic rinse: perform a generous enzyme soak, allow dwell time, then rinse. Repeat the next day for heavy use zones.
  • Odor after rain: the base may be holding water. Check slope, clear drains, and consider adding a drain line if the subgrade is slow.
  • Stale, swampy smell: remove trapped debris, groom the turf, and verify the base is open graded and not compacted fines.
  • Localized hotspot: lift the edge if accessible to inspect the base and confirm it is clean and draining. Correct any low pocket.

Time and cost snapshot

  • Routine care for 200 square feet typically takes 5 to 10 minutes per week.
  • Enzyme cleaner budget is often 15 to 25 dollars per month for average dog use.
  • Annual zeolite top off can range from roughly 0.40 to 1.00 dollars per square foot depending on product and traffic.
